Vesxbit.com Review – Low Trust Signals, Credibility Gaps & High-Risk Exchange Indicators

Vesxbit.com Review – Low Trust Signals, Credibility Gaps & High-Risk Exchange Indicators

Vesxbit.com is being promoted online as a cryptocurrency trading/exchange-style platform. However, multiple independent risk-scoring systems flag the domain with very low trust metrics, and the site itself was not reliably accessible during our check—both of which are common warning signs in high-risk crypto platform investigations. Site Accessibility and Visibility Concerns

When attempting to load vesxbit.com, the page did not return readable content in our retrieval check. While downtime can happen for legitimate services, persistent accessibility issues—especially for deposit-taking “exchanges”—can also indicate instability, geoblocking, or short-lived operations. Independent Trust Scores Flag Vesxbit.com as High Risk

Two separate security/risk evaluators assign very low trust to Vesxbit.com:

  • Scam Detector assigns vesxbit.com a low trust score (12.6) and labels the profile as risky/untrustworthy. (Scam Detector)
  • Gridinsoft flags vesxbit.com with an extremely low trust score (1/100) and classifies it as suspicious. (Gridinsoft LLC)

Low trust scoring is not a conviction by itself, but when multiple systems converge on a similar conclusion, it becomes a meaningful risk signal—especially in the crypto exchange category.

Domain/Network Pattern: Similar Names, Multiple TLDs

One common pattern in exchange-impersonation and “clone exchange” activity is the reuse of similar branding across multiple domains and extensions. Public risk pages also exist for similarly named domains (e.g., “vesxbit.net” showing different scoring outcomes), which further reinforces the need to verify you’re dealing with the correct, legitimate entity—if one exists. (ScamAdviser)

For clarity: this review is about Vesxbit.com (the .com domain), which is the one receiving the low trust flags above. (Scam Detector)

What These Signals Typically Mean for Users

Platforms that trigger this combination of signals often share familiar operational risks:

  • unclear ownership/accountability
  • weak reputation footprint relative to claims
  • unstable availability or sudden access restrictions
  • increased probability of withdrawal friction (holds, “verification” payments, fee demands)

Even if a platform looks “professional,” risk scoring and transparency signals frequently reveal a very different reality.

Final Assessment

Based on:

  • very low trust scoring from multiple independent evaluators (Scam Detector)
  • accessibility/visibility issues during review (VestraLX)

Vesxbit.com should be treated as high risk.

Risk Level: High
Status: Not Recommended
